Ren Ziwei was born on June 3, 1997 in Harbin, Heilongjiang, and when he was 7 years old, he was selected by the coach of the Nangang District Sports School to start short track speed skating training.

Injury is every athlete's biggest enemy to success, and Ren Ziwei is no different. In 2010, Ren Ziwei fractured his left foot. Children are the heart of parents, seeing her son lying on the hospital bed in pain, Ren Ziwei's mother cried and directly said to the coach, "Our children are not practicing." ”

Although Ren Ziwei was only 13 years old at this time, he had big ideas. He already has his own independent thoughts, his own opinions. Ren Ziwei persuaded his parents to continue practicing.

During the period of recovery after the injury, he could not practice his lower limbs, so he practiced upper limb strength, exercised abs, back muscles... There was hardly much delay in training. Seeing that their son was so insistent, the parents finally agreed to Ren Ziwei to continue practicing short track speed skating.

However, God continued to test Ren Ziwei. A year later, Ren Ziwei fractured his right foot in a match. This time injured, Ren Ziwei's mother was iron-hearted, "My son is not this piece of material, his bones are too fragile." ”

With the encouragement of the coach, Ren Ziwei walked out of the injury, and the goal was clearer - to enter the national team. The injured Ren Ziwei practiced twice a day, sweating profusely for his goals and ideals, and Ren Ziwei's mother once again "compromised".

One day, the coach's students came to the team with the gold medal of the World Cup champion, and Ren Ziwei happened to be there. Seeing the golden gold medal, Ren Ziwei was eager to hang it on his neck immediately, so he asked the coach if he could borrow the gold medal to wear. The gold medal hung on Ren Ziwei's chest, and he carefully stroked it, reluctant to take it off. At this time, Ren Ziwei secretly decided to become a world champion and get his own gold medal.

With this goal, Ren Ziwei "slid" from the city team to the national team, from the national champion to the world champion and the Olympic champion. In 2014, the 17-year-old Ren Ziwei was promoted to the national team less than two years after entering the city team.

After entering the national team, Li Yan, then the head coach of the national short track speed skating team, gave Ren Ziwei a nickname "elephant". Li Yan said that Ren Ziwei rushing up will give people a feeling of courage and unstoppable, like an elephant. In the Beijing Winter Olympic cycle, Ren Ziwei's performance was very eye-catching. The World Cup in Dresden in early 2020 broke South Korea's long monopoly on the men's 1500m title. In the 4 World Cup series, Ren Ziwei won 3 individual gold medals. His strong performance has injected a booster into the Chinese short track speed skating team.

In the short track speed skating mixed relay competition the day before yesterday, Ren Ziwei cooperated with his teammates to win the opening for the Chinese delegation. Today, he won the men's 1000m. Judging from the current state, Ren Ziwei is likely to stand on the highest podium in the back games and become the gold king of this Winter Olympics. When the gold medal of the Olympic champion was hung on his chest, Ren Ziwei said excitedly: "I have fantasized countless times that I should say and do what to say when I stand here, but I really have to stand here, and suddenly I don't know what to say, I am happy..."
